Two men, Benigno and Marco, sit next to each other in a theatre, by chance. Months later, they meet at a private clinic where Benigno works as sole carer to Alicia, a young ballet student in a coma. Marco's girlfriend, Lydia, a bullfighter by profession, has been gored and is also in a coma.

It is the start of an intense friendship between the two men as they care for the women they love. During this period of suspended time between the walls of the clinic, the lives of the four characters will flow in all directions, past, present and future, leading them towards an unsuspected destiny.

With the inclusion of an extremely memorable film within a film entitled The Shrinking Lover, which Almodovar utilises to sensuously illustrate his storytelling, he has again employed art and performance to play a large part with appearances by renowned musician Caetano Veloso as well as a pivotal performance by dancer Pina Bausch.

Talk To Her is about loyalty, about loneliness and the long convalescence of the wounds provoked by passion.
